From one of the co-creators of a genre comes another first in musical doorways opened. Dan Spitz (formerly co-writer, co-producer and lead guitarist of Anthrax), a three-time Grammy nominee who has sold 20 million+ albums and has his music playing on MARS alongside Frank Sinatra and The Beatles with NASA, is now playing an extremely rare to be seen or heard Weissenborn Lap Slide Guitar for a cause, for a mission, and for changing all planetsâ views on the words âAutism Awarenessâ through the most powerful way known, MUSIC.
The music video premiere for âLittle Voicesâ by the DII Band (also featuring Don Chaffin on vocals), is being touted by the press as âthe first Autism anthem song for all generations and genres of musicâ, is exclusive to BlankTV.com today! Go to BlankTV at 9:00PM EDT to be a part of what Dan Spitz calls âLevel 2 of Awarenessâ.
Original music, including complete re-makes of some of Dan Spitz’s past Anthrax works he has co-written such as âI Am The Lawâ and âIndiansâ, are available via iTunes this week with a video for âI Am The Lawâ to be released soon. The physical release of the DII CD and more will hit the masses in August 2014 through Sony Red / MRI Entertainment / Smashmouth Records. In addition to this record, three masterpiece videos directed by Don Chaffin will be released. DII band originals are an emotional walk through relationship areas and everyday lifeâs struggles and truth.

Dan Spitz explains the lyrical content of âLittle Voicesâ, âThe unwritten words and bond of love between children on the Autism Spectrum and their parent is something unexplained. It is what the song âLittle Voicesâ conveys in its message. The word Autism is not used at all in the lyrical content just for that reason. It need NOT be said. It just can’t be. The words will bring you through an emotional ride so real, no matter who you are, good luck not being touched in some form or fashion.â

Dan Spitz is a single father to identical twin sons who are both on the Autism spectrum and his life-long goal is to help children and families through these avenues, and to enlighten the public to the word Autism, with zero connection to any organization. A relentless task of work ethic placed upon him and his heart to do so. According to the CDC, as of 2014, 1 in 42 boys born, 1 in 68 children will be on the autism spectrum.
DII is one powerful musical duo. Dan Spitz has put down his electric guitar and reinvented himself as an artist by learning this rare Weissenborn Lap Slide instrument played by few, and mastered by only a handful on the planet. In quiet seclusion and secrecy kept by many helping him achieve his goals, Spitz relentlessly had to un-learn old skills, to acquire a new. With long time musical partner, vocalist Don Chaffin, administering his soulful and heart felt lyrical avenues of execution, the listener will be instantly taken on a journey so familiar of the greatest singers of all time, yet a sound from this duo is of none present, past, or can be duplicated into the future.
